Russians becoming Dominant Force in Turkish Property Sales - 13 Aug 2011
According to a report in Turkish news website the National Turk, British property owners on the Aegean coast are selling up en masse because of the looming European financial crisis. The report said that Russians are stepping up as buyers for the properties.

US Foreclosures at 4 Yr Low, but No Recovery Yet - 13 Aug 2011
Is this a sign of hope at last for the US housing market. According to well respected foreclosure researchers Realty Trac foreclosures fell 35% last month, taking them to a 4 year low

Cuban Government Looks Set to Legalise Property Transactions - 11 Aug 2011
The Cuban government promised last week that it would legalise buying and selling property by the end of the year, and if this happens it is possible that Cuba may face a property boom

Antalya Tourism up 13% This Year - 10 Aug 2011
Tourism to Antalya is almost 15% higher this year according to new data. According to the Antalya Culture and Tourism Directorate Antalya welcomed 13% more tourists between Jan 1 and August 7 this year than it did during the same period last year

US Home Ownership Hits 13 Yr Low, Spurs Rental Market - 8 Aug 2011
Home ownership in the US has fallen to its lowest level in 13 years as the foreclosure process lengthens and banks start knocking down homes they can't sell, because they can no longer afford to tax or maintain them
